Interim Head of Legal & Data Protection (Maternity Cover)
Role Purpose
To provide senior interim leadership across the firm's Legal and Data Protection functions The role holds responsibility for continuity of live litigation and complaints, oversight of the Data Protection team and senior stakeholder engagement across the wider Risk function.
Key Responsibilities
Litigation & Complaints
Own and progress all live litigation matters and firm complaints, including settlement strategy.
Manage engagement with professional bodies and regulatory correspondence.
Instruct and manage external litigation panel firms as required.
Provide judgment-based advice to the Head of Risk on high-stakes disputes.
Data Protection & Governance
Provide day-to-day leadership and direction to the Data Protection team.
Oversee DPIAs, transfer assessments, and integration-related DP workstreams.
Continue the firm's EU AI Act readiness programme and AI literacy training oversight.
Represent the DP function at senior leadership and Risk forums.
Team Leadership & Development
Lead, support, and develop the Legal and Data Protection team members.
Maintain team cohesion, workload balance, and wellbeing.
Provide coaching and technical guidance to junior team members, particularly within DP.
Strong litigation and complaints experience within a regulated professional services environment.
Significant Data Protection experience essential.
Commercial contracts literacy to backstop the contracts team.
Proven people leadership experience across multidisciplinary teams, including junior lawyers.
Senior stakeholder gravitas.
Sound judgment and ability to make binding decisions on litigation, regulatory, and escalation matters independently.
Desirable Criteria
Prior in-house experience in a Big 4 or top-tier professional services firm.
Familiarity with professional body regulation (CAI, ACCA, ICAEW).
Significant Data Protection experience
Exposure to cross-jurisdictional matters (IE, UK/NI, IoM, Bermuda, Gibraltar, US).
Experience of firm integrations or global platform transitions.
